数据库管理员 (DBA) 的角色在不断发展,以适应技术和应用程序开发方法的变化。DBA 曾经主要专注于管理物理硬件和软件,但现在他们发现自己正在应对复杂的云技术、人工智能驱动的自动化和不断增加的数据量。在 2025 年初,让我们来探讨DBA 应该关注的五大问题。
数据安全和隐私
数据泄露事件不断成为头条新闻,其后果可能是灾难性的。DBA 站在保护敏感信息的第一线。根据 IBM 最近的一项研究,数据泄露的平均成本已上升至 488 万美元。因此,应该保持警惕,尽量避免数据泄露!
由于 DBA 每天都在处理数据,因此他们经常需要实施策略来抵御潜在的数据窃贼。保护数据的一种技术是加密静态和传输中的数据。另一种方法是实施强大的访问控制来限制谁可以访问和修改数据。
最后,遵守 GDPR、HIPAA 和 PCI-DSS 等行业法规至关重要。更不用说需要考虑的州和地方法规数量正在不断增加。这些法规规定了必须实施的特定类型的保护和治理,以确保合规性。
需要高级工具来检测和应对潜在威胁。这意味着 DBA 需要掌握使用数据库防火墙、数据屏蔽工具、加密工具、入侵检测和预防系统 (IDPS)、安全信息和事件管理 (SIEM) 以及数据库活动监控和审计工具等工具的技能。
2.云迁移挑战
随着组织将其数据库迁移到云中以获得可扩展性、灵活性和成本节省,独特的管理挑战也随之而来。DBA必须熟悉云技术并了解其使用方式。这意味着要熟悉顶级的基于云的数据库平台,例如 Amazon Web Services (AWS)、Microsoft Azure、Google Cloud Platform (GCP)、Oracle Cloud 和 IBM Cloud 平台。
此外,DBA 还应熟练掌握基于云的数据存储和管理工具,例如 Amazon S3 和 Google Cloud Storage。
随着数据转移到云中,DBA 需要继续确保其数据安全并符合相关法规。DBA 必须与其组织的安全团队密切合作,以识别和解决潜在的安全风险,例如上面第 1 项中讨论的风险。
此外,DBA 必须了解其组织与每个云服务提供商 (CSP) 签订的合同。CSP 负责哪些管理方面,哪些留给 DBA 团队?了解 DBA 团队涵盖哪些内容以及哪些内容仍必须在本地处理至关重要。
此外,DBA 应该了解云合同的成本方面。虽然云计算使扩展以处理更大的工作负载变得更加容易,但它也使成本的增加变得更加容易。自动扩展非常适合处理不断增长的工作负载,但当账单到来时也会产生冲击。DBA 需要了解他们的云数据库是如何被访问的,并有适当的方法来应对和报告扩展及其相关成本。
3.人工智能和自动化
人工智能和自动化正在改变 DBA 的工作方式。虽然这些技术提供了显著的好处,但也引发了担忧。担心自动化取代人类工作是合理的。DBA 需要掌握新技能才能有效地使用人工智能和自动化工具。但过度依赖人工智能可能会导致漏洞。
AI 对 DBA 的一些影响包括:
- 使用人工智能改进自动化,创造智能自动化,可以根据对过去活动和结果的了解来执行任务。
- 人工智能工具可以实时监控和优化数据库性能,减少停机时间并提高系统可靠性。
- 使用算法的人工智能改进的安全性可以分析数据库访问模式并检测表明欺诈和违规的异常。
4.融入DevOps实践
DevOps 和敏捷开发方法的兴起从根本上改变了软件的开发和部署方式。DBA 必须与 DevOps 团队密切合作,以确保数据库无缝集成到开发和部署过程中。这包括自动化数据库部署、版本控制以及持续集成和交付 (CI/CD)。当然,这说起来容易做起来难,不仅需要实施强大的工具和自动化,还需要组织程序和人员的理念变革。
5.数据增长和存储
另一个问题是处理组织积累和管理的不断增长的数据量。数据的这种指数级增长对 DBA 来说是一个持续的挑战。存储大量数据的成本可能很高。大型数据集会影响查询性能和响应时间。
有效的数据生命周期管理对于最大限度地降低存储成本和提高性能至关重要。数据是在某个时刻创建的,通常是通过交易创建的,在创建后的一段时间内,数据进入其运行状态,需要数据来完成正在进行的业务交易。这是它实现其主要业务目的的地方。交易在此状态下对数据进行,大多数更改发生在其运行状态下。接下来是参考状态,需要数据用于报告和查询目的,但它不一定推动业务交易。最后,它会被移动到存档状态,然后被丢弃。每个状态都需要不同类型的存储和管理来实现业务目的、维持成本并提供所需的性能。
最终结论
通过主动解决这些问题,DBA 可以确保其数据库的可靠性、安全性和性能。随着技术格局的不断发展,DBA 必须保持领先地位并采用新的工具和技术。
原文地址:https://www.dbta.com/Columns/DBA-Corner/Top-5-DBA-Concerns-in-the-Age-of-AI-and-Cloud-167993.aspx
原文作者:Craig S. Mullins